LEGAL CITATIONS

Legal citations are sometimes confusing to beginning legal researchers. However, once you understand how they are put together, you can find just about any published case in our collection without any assistance.

In short, every reporter citation has three component parts which are always given in the same order:

265
Volume Number

U.S.
Name of Reporter Title
274
Beginning Page Number

Reporters are simply books which publish court cases or opinions in serial fashion (i.e. in an ongoing series of volumes). To assist legal researchers in locating court opinions, most legal publishers will give you citations to all the standard sources:

For example: 93 S.Ct. 705, 410 U.S. 113, 35 L.Ed. 2nd 147
Or for state cases: 45 Ohio St. 2d 107, 341 N.E. 2d 576

You only need to look at one of these cites since they include the same opinion on the same case when they are strung together in this manner. In the first example, you could look at any one of three books. In the second, either one of two books.
